Special Aircraft Service
Battlefield - Airborne - Tactical (BAT) => BAT Tech Help => Topic started by: laugust5 on January 09, 2017, 09:54:44 PM
-
Hello:
Testing my BAT install and have another discrepancy.
There is a difference between the JU-88A4 weapons loadout that is available in the game & the JU-88A4 weapons properties located in the \#WAW2\STD\i18n\weapon.properties.
The original properties for the JU-88A4 is this was as follows:
#####################################################################
# Ju-88A-4
#####################################################################
Ju-88A-4.default Standard
Ju-88A-4.28xSC50 28xSC 50
Ju-88A-4.28xSC50_2xSC250 28xSC 50 + 2xSC 250
Ju-88A-4.28xSC50_4xSC250 28xSC 50 + 4xSC 250
Ju-88A-4.18xSC50_2xSC500 18xSC 50 + 2xSC 500
Ju-88A-4.18xSC50_4xSC500 18xSC 50 + 4xSC 500
Ju-88A-4.10xSC50 10xSC 50
Ju-88A-4.10xSC50_2xSC250 10xSC 50 + 2xSC 250
Ju-88A-4.10xSC50_4xSC250 10xSC 50 + 4xSC 250
Ju-88A-4.4xSC250 4xSC 250
Ju-88A-4.6xSC250 6xSC 250
Ju-88A-4.2xSC500 2xSC 500
Ju-88A-4.2xAB500 2xAB 500
Ju-88A-4.4xSC500 4xSC 500
Ju-88A-4.4xAB500 4xAB 500
Ju-88A-4.2xSC1000 2xSC 1000
Ju-88A-4.2xAB1000 2xAB 1000
Ju-88A-4.2xSC1800 1xSC 1800
Ju-88A-4.2xSC2000 1xSC 2000
Ju-88A-4.1xSC1000 1xSC 1000
Ju-88A-4.1xSC1000_1xSC250 1xSC1000 + 1xSC250
Ju-88A-4.1xSC1000_1xSC500 1xSC 1000 + 1xSC 500
Ju-88A-4.2xSC1000_2xSC500 2xSC 1000 + 2xSC 500
Ju-88A-4.2xLT350 2xLT350 Torpedo
Ju-88A-4.4xLT350 4xLT350 Torpedo
Ju-88A-4.none Keine
When testing my newly installed BAT using a mission using the JU-88A4, there was a "pink airplane issue". I remembered having an issue with the JU-88A4 weapons loadout early in my original CUP. I received the following help from Moezilla:
https://www.sas1946.com/main/index.php/topic,51319.0.html
Which involved a JSGME mod & replacing the weapons properties for the JU-88A4 with the following information:
#####################################################################
# Ju-88A-4
#####################################################################
Ju-88A-4.default Default
Ju-88A-4.28xSC50 28xSC 50
Ju-88A-4.28xSC50_2xSC250 28xSC 50 + 2xSC 250
Ju-88A-4.28xSC50_4xSC250 28xSC 50 + 4xSC 250
Ju-88A-4.18xSC50_2xSC500 18xSC 50 + 2xSC 500
Ju-88A-4.18xSC50_4xSC500 18xSC 50 + 4xSC 500
Ju-88A-4.10xSC50 10xSC 50 + 900kg fuel
Ju-88A-4.10xSC50_2xSC250 10xSC 50 + 2xSC 250 + 900kg fuel
Ju-88A-4.10xSC50_4xSC250 10xSC 50 + 4xSC 250 + 900kg fuel
Ju-88A-4.4xSC250 4xSC 250
Ju-88A-4.6xSC250 6xSC 250
Ju-88A-4.2xSC500 2xSC 500
Ju-88A-4.2xAB500 2xAB 500
Ju-88A-4.4xSC500 4xSC 500
Ju-88A-4.4xAB500 4xAB 500
Ju-88A-4.2xSC1000 2xSC 1000
Ju-88A-4.2xAB1000 2xAB 1000
Ju-88A-4.2xSC1800 1xSC 1800
Ju-88A-4.2xSC2000 1xSC 2000
Ju-88A-4.1xSC1000 1xSC 1000
Ju-88A-4.1xSC1000_1xSC250 1xSC 1000 + 1xSC 250
Ju-88A-4.1xSC1000_1xSC500 1xSC 1000 + 1xSC 500
Ju-88A-4.2xSC1000_2xSC500 2xSC 1000 + 2xSC 500
Ju-88A-4.2xLT350 2xLT350 Torpedos
Ju-88A-4.2xLMB 2xLMB Sea Mines
Ju-88A-4.2xBM1000_I_1 2xBM1000-I Case 1 Mines
Ju-88A-4.2xBM1000_II_3 2xBM1000-II Case 3 Mines
Ju-88A-4.2xBM1000_III_B 2xBM1000-IIIB Mines
Ju-88A-4.2xBM1000_IV 2xBM1000-IV Mines
Ju-88A-4.4xLMA_I 4xLMA-I Sea Mines
Ju-88A-4.4xLMA_II 4xLMA-II Sea Mines
Ju-88A-4.4xBM250 4xBM250 Sea Mines
Ju-88A-4.none Empty
This solved the pink airplane issue and the airplane works in BAT, but the weapons loadout for the JU-88 in the game is not correct:
Here are 4 screenshots that show in order the available loadouts, which don't match the current weapons properties.
(https://s27.postimg.cc/mltlnjr4j/2017_01_10_04_19_07.jpg) (https://postimg.cc/image/mltlnjr4f/)
(https://s30.postimg.cc/lqhltrua9/2017_01_10_04_19_20.jpg) (https://postimg.cc/image/5s8w3n025/)
(https://s23.postimg.cc/3ouox8ve3/2017_01_10_04_19_45.jpg) (https://postimg.cc/image/i81tynoiv/)
(https://s24.postimg.cc/e15865mx1/2017_01_10_04_19_54.jpg) (https://postimg.cc/image/nlout1c8x/)
So, are ther any ideas about what could be causing the discrepancy and how to fix it....FYI. I tried to use the #WAW20_Ju88A4Fix JSGEM Mod that Moezilla made for CUP, that made no difference in the available loadout whether the Mod was activated or not.
Any ideas suggestions appreciated.
many thanks.
laen
-
Not sure how much that mod you've installed is suitable for BAT at all, but what you see is the standard weapons.properties from BAT's "#WAW2\STD\i18n" folder, and there the Ju-88A-4 loadouts are indeed wrong:
################################################################################
# Ju-88A-4 ## JU_88A4 ### "Junkers Ju88A-4, 1941" #### 194101--194506
################################################################################
Ju-88A-4.default Default
Ju-88A-4.28xSC50 28xSC 50
Ju-88A-4.28xSC50_2xSC250 28xSC 50 + 2xSC 250
Ju-88A-4.18xSC50_2xSC500 18xSC 50 + 2xSC 500
Ju-88A-4.10xSC50 GE 10xSC 50
Ju-88A-4.10xSC50_2xSC250 10xSC 50 + 2xSC 250 + 900kg fuel
Ju-88A-4.4xSC250 4 x SC250kg
Ju-88A-4.2xSC500 2 x SC500kg
Ju-88A-4.4xSC500 2xSC 500
Ju-88A-4.2xAB500 $2xAB500
Ju-88A-4.4xAB500 2xAB 500
Ju-88A-4.2xSC1000 2xSC 1000
Ju-88A-4.2xAB1000 2xAB 1000
Ju-88A-4.2xSC1800 2xSC 1800
Ju-88A-4.2xSC2000 1xSC 2000
Ju-88A-4.4xBM250 $4xBM250
Ju-88A-4.2xLMB $2xLMB
Ju-88A-4.2xBM1000_I_1 $2xBM1000_I_1
Ju-88A-4.2xBM1000_II_3 $2xBM1000_II_3
Ju-88A-4.2xBM1000_III_B $2xBM1000_III_B
Ju-88A-4.2xBM1000_IV $2xBM1000_IV
Ju-88A-4.4xLMA_I $4xLMA_I
Ju-88A-4.4xLMA_II $4xLMA_II
Ju-88A-4.none Empty
The best way to fix this is probably to just use Notepad and write down correct entries instead or wait for a BAT patch fixing this file.
Best regards - Mike
-
Thanks for the reply. I'm uninstalling that CUP Mod #WAW_JU-88A4_Fix...it didn't do anything at any rate.
I can easily edit the weapons.properties in "#WAW2\STD\i18n" folder using Notepad...
So do I understand correctly that the code you posted is the CORRECT weapons.properties for BAT JU-88A4 including the "Header?
################################################################################
# Ju-88A-4 ## JU_88A4 ### "Junkers Ju88A-4, 1941" #### 194101--194506
################################################################################
Laen
-
No, that's the code you will find inside weapons.properties from BAT "#WAW2\STD\i18n" folder.
It's the wrong code and needs to be edited.
Best regards - Mike
-
Sir
After taking a second look...
I realized that the code I was posting in my first message was not the weapons.properties, but rather the "weapons_de.properties" inside the "#WAW2\STD\i18n I corrected it back to the original...but when I look at the plain weapons.properties file, that shows exactly the code you have posted.
The plane is flying, but it does not make available the full loadout options that are normal. Only the options that I show in the screenshots.
I guess I'm a bit confused what exactly you are suggesting I edit the "weapons.properties" inside "#WAW2\STD\i18n to read for the JU-88A4?
Thanks & sorry to be dense.
laen
-
Well...
This will become messy.
The underlying issue is a mixture of issues.
Let's see what we have:
- The Ju-88A-4's weapon declarations file (a so called "cod'ded" encryption weapons file) doesn't have all available loadouts listed as they appear in weapons.properties.
This is something to be fixed by the modder who did that cod file. - Some of the Ju-88A-4's weapon declarations from the cod file are plain wrong.
For instance the single SC-1800 and single SC-2000 loadouts show a pair of these bombs instead.
That's simply an impossible load for a Ju-88A-4 and needs to fixed by the modder who did the cod file again. - IL-2 loads weapons.properties files according to your PC's or your game's language specification.
You can setup the language in conf.ini file, [rts] section, line "locale=en" for instance for english language or "locale=de" for german.
If no such line in conf.ini exists, the game tries to match the locale of your operating system installation.
properties files are loaded with the locale in respect, meaning the game will first try to load the property from the matching locale file, and only if that file doesn't exist or the property in question doesn't exist inside that file, or if your locale is english, it will use the "default" properties file.
This means that if your locale is german, the game will try to load the Ju-88A-4 loadout options from weapons_de.properties.
Since they exist inside that file, they will be loaded from there.
Wouldn't they exist, or would your locale be english, then the file weapons.properties would be used instead. - The contents from weapons.properties and the locale versions like weapons_de.properties don't match for the Ju-88A-4.
Apparently someone created a massive mess here.
These files are ASCII text files so any user can fix them and, if he's kind to others, share his fixes.
Best regards - Mike
-
Moezilla's fix was made for WAW but it should work in WAW2 as well. I will take a look at it later...
-
OK Sirs. Thanks for the information.
FYI I checked my config.ini and in [rts] I have locale=...in other words nothing. Not sure if that is a problem?
Since attempting to fix this on my own with the Moezilla fix, which DID NOT solve the issue when activated in JSGME, I have since deactivated & deleted the #WAW_JU88A4_fix file from my BATMODS folder.
In addition the JU-88A4 coding for the "weapons.properties" & the "weapons_properties.de" inside my "#WAW2\STD\i18n are back to the original state that they were after installing BAT thru expansion pack 4.
For now the JU-88 works in the game, its just frustrating that the correct weapons loadout options for this aircraft are not available. perhaps the issue can be resolved with a future expansion pack update.
If there is something that I am missing, please inform me.
laen
-
This issue is now resolved. I loaded the alternate dll files trying to solve another issue & coincidently I find that the correct JU-88A4 loadouts are now available...this could have been fixed with the latest expansion pack...Not sure..anyway its fixed on my game.
Thanks
-
Thread title edited ;)